My First Craft Fair!


So after months of planning and trying to make inventory every spare moment, my first craft fair has come and went. Boy, was it alot of work, but oh was it fun!

I used this craft fair as a thumbprint for the many more I hope to do. Figuring out my display was a hurtle but I really heart it.



Anthropologie is always a source of inspiration for me so I tried to use that to create a display I was pretty happy with.



The branch is from my front yard and was perfect with a quick coat of turquoise spray paint for my headbands. Some thrifty finds and some borrowed things pulled it all together.

My friend Jill from Three Little Rosebuds shared space with me. Aren't her canvases so adorable?


Especially this one that I'm dying for.


It sold first for her. Yay! She was also the show coordinator and did a fabulous job!

It was great to get feedback from the public about my product. Sales weren't too shabby either.

Always nice to take on a new adventure and be pleased with the results!
